Southern Ocean Lodge invites guests to experience the wild beauty of Kangaroo Island through an immersive photographic journey led by acclaimed travel photographer and Canon Master Richard I'Anson.

With just ten guests, the KI Photo Safari is an intimate, four-night expedition designed to capture the island's extraordinary landscapes and abundant wildlife. Guided by Richard's expert eye, each day unfolds from first light to golden hour, with hands-on tuition and informal feedback supporting both the technical and creative aspects of travel photography.

Often described as Australia's own Galapagos, Kangaroo Island offers a rich and varied canvas - from rugged coastlines and soaring limestone cliffs to turquoise bays, mallee scrub and eucalypt forests. Wildlife encounters are equally compelling, with opportunities to photograph sea lions, fur seals, koalas and kangaroos in their natural habitat.

Highlights include sunrise access at Seal Bay, golden hour sessions at the sculptural Remarkable Rocks, and visits to Admirals Arch and Cape du Couedic Lighthouse. A pre-dawn shoot is rewarded with a gourmet beachside breakfast, while evenings invite fireside conversation and image review back at the lodge.

With Southern Ocean Lodge as a luxurious basecamp, this thoughtfully curated safari blends creative exploration with relaxed hospitality - offering a rare opportunity to see, learn and capture Kangaroo Island through a master's lens.
